Engine Coolant
The cooling system in your vehicle is filled with
DEX-COOL@ engine coolant. This coolant is designed
to remain in your vehicle for 5 years or 150,000 miles
(240
000 km), whichever occurs first, if you add
only DEX-COOL@ extended life coolant.
The following explains your cooling system and how to
add coolant when it is low.
If you have a problem
with engine overheating, see
Engine Overheating on
page
5-26.
A 5060 mixture of clean, drinkable water and
DEX-COOL@ coolant will:
Give freezing protection down to -34°F (-37°C).
Give boiling protection up to 265°F
(129°C).
0 Protect against rust and corrosion.
Help keep the proper engine temperature.
Let the warning messages and gages work as they
should.
Notice: When adding coolant, it is important that
you use only
DEX-COOL@ (silicate-free) coolant.
If coolant other than DEX-COOL@ is added to
the system, premature engine, heater core or
radiator corrosion may result. In addition, the engine
coolant will require change sooner
-- at 30,000 miles
(50,000 km) or 24 months, whichever occurs first.
Damage caused by the use
of coolant other
than DEX-COOL@
is not covered by your new
vehicle warranty.

What to Use
Use a mixture of one-half clean, drinkable water and
one-half
DEX-COOL@ coolant which won’t damage
aluminum parts.
If you use this coolant mixture,
you don’t need
to add anything else.
Adding on
, plain wa ~ ~ * to your cooling
system can be dangerous. Plain water, or
some other liquid such as alcohol, can boil
before the proper coolant mixture will. Your
vehicle’s coolant warning system
is set for the
proper coolant mixture.
With plain water or the
wrong mixture, your engine could get too hot but you wouldn’t get the overheat warning.
Your engine could catch fire and you or others
could be burned. Use a
50/50 mixture of clean,
drinkable water and
DEX-COOL@ coolant.
Notice: If you use an improper coolant mixture,
your engine could overheat and be badly damaged.
The repair cost wouldn’t be covered by your
warranty.
Too much water in the mixture can freeze
and crack the engine, radiator, heater core and
other parts.
If you have to add coolant more than four times a year,
have your dealer check your cooling system.
Notice: If you use the proper coolant, you don’t
have to add extra inhibitors or additives which claim
to improve the system. These can be harmful.

Overheated Engine Protection
Operating Mode
This emergency operating mode allows your vehicle to
be driven to a safe place in an emergency situation.
If an overheated engine condition exists, an overheat
protection mode which alternates firing groups of
cylinders helps prevent engine damage.
In this mode,
you will notice a significant
loss in power and engine
performance. The temperature gage will indicate
an overheat condition exists. Driving extended miles
(km) and/or towing a trailer in the overheat protection
mode should be avoided.
Notice: After driving in the overheated engine
protection operating mode, to avoid engine damage,
allow the engine to cool before attempting any repair. The engine oil will be severely degraded.
Repair the cause
of coolant loss, change the oil
and reset the
oil life system. See “Engine Oil” in
the Index.

If Steam Is Coming From Your Engine
Steam fr n a rheated engine 4 urn
you badly, even if you just open the hood. Stay away from the engine if you see or hear
steam coming from
it. Just turn it off and get
everyone away from the vehicle
until it cools
down. Wait
until there is no sign of steam or
coolant before you open the hood.
If you keep driving when your engine is
overheated, the liquids in
it can catch fire.
You or others could be badly burned. Stop
your engine if
it overheats, and get out of the
vehicle until the engine
is cool.
See “Overheated Engine Protection Operating
Mode”
in the Index for information on driving
to a safe place
in an emergency.
Notice: If your engine catches fire because you keep
driving with no coolant, your vehicle can be badly
damaged. The costly repairs would not be covered by
your warranty. See “Overheated Engine Protection
Operating Mode”
in the Index for information on
driving to a safe place in an emergency.

The coolant level should be at or above the FULL COLD
mark. If it isn’t, you may have a leak at the pressure cap
or in the radiator hoses, heater hoses, radiator, water
pump or somewhere else in the cooling system. Heater
and radiator hoses, and other engine
parts, can be very hot. Don’t touch them.
If you do, you can
be burned.
Don’t run the engine
if there is a leak. If you run
the engine,
it could lose all coolant. That could
cause an engine fire, and you could be burned.
Get any leak fixed before you drive the vehicle.
If there seems to be no leak, with the engine on, check
to see
if the electric engine cooling fans are running.
If the engine is overheating, both fans should be
running. If they aren’t, your vehicle needs service.
